In this study, we report a series of highly water-soluble fluorogenic probes for glycosidases useful for microdevice-based single-molecule enzyme activity profiling (SEAP). The assay was able to detect trace glycosidase activities in blood with high sensitivity and with proteoform resolution. This platform revealed the potential of -mannosidase as sensitive blood-based liquid-biopsy biomarkers for liver injury, highlighting the potential of this approach for activity-based diagnostics.
